      Hello and thank you for the question regarding CMS138v12 Preventive Care and Screening: Tobacco Use: Screening and Cessation Intervention.

      Under a shared EHR, patients associated with the eligible clinicians in your organization will be counted in the measure, irrespective of whether they received care in the inpatient or ambulatory setting. Because CMS138v12 contains inpatient codes, patients will be included in the Initial Population who have at least two Qualifying Visits during the measurement period or one Preventive Visit.

    • We have no way of working IPP from a system that is not ours.

      We pay a hospital for the use of the ambulatory side of their EHR. Our surgeons also perform surgeries and hospital rounding on the hospital's in-patient system as they do at other hospitals in the area. 

      The hospital is counting the in-patient encounters of our EC's on their system in our measures. Specifically eCQM CMS-138 Tobacco Screening and Cessation. We do not report together. Other than our providers, our staff do not have access to the in-patient side of the system. We have no way to perform the workflow to meet the numerator as it is not in our ambulatory system. We are not expected to this for other hospitals our EC's see patients.

      Is it correct for the hospital to count the in-patient encounters in our IPP?
